What are the advantages of Rust over other systems programming languages?
The advantages of Rust over other systems programming languages include its memory safety features, which prevent common bugs like null pointer dereferences and buffer overflows, as well as its performance comparable to C and C++, making it ideal for high-performance applications.
How does Rust improve system security and reliability?
Rust improves system security and reliability through its strict memory safety guarantees and ownership model, which prevent common programming errors such as null pointer dereferences and data races, leading to more robust and secure applications.

How does Rust support concurrency in systems programming?
Rust supports concurrency in systems programming by using a unique ownership model that ensures memory safety without needing a garbage collector. This allows developers to write concurrent code that is both efficient and free from data races.
Is Rust suitable for building operating system kernels?
Rust is suitable for building operating system kernels due to its performance, memory safety, and concurrency features, making it an excellent choice for low-level programming tasks while minimizing common bugs and vulnerabilities.

How does Rust handle memory management in system programming?
Rust handles memory management in system programming through its ownership model, which enforces strict rules on how memory is allocated and deallocated, ensuring safety and preventing common issues like null pointer dereferencing and data races without a garbage collector.

What are common interview questions for Rust engineers?
Common interview questions for Rust engineers typically include inquiries about ownership and borrowing concepts, memory safety, concurrency, and specific Rust features like traits and lifetimes, as well as practical coding challenges to assess proficiency.
How do Rust developers ensure code quality?
Rust developers ensure code quality through rigorous testing, leveraging Rust's strong type system, and employing tools like Clippy and Rustfmt for linting and formatting. These practices help identify issues early and maintain clean, efficient code.
